Brigham Young was an early convert to the Mormon Church, which was founded in 1830 by Joseph Smith, Young's relative by marriage. Young quickly advanced within the Mormon hierarchy, becoming president of the Quorum of the Twelve Apostles (the governing body of the church). After Smith's death in 1844, various leaders asserted their claims to become his successor. Booker Taliaferro Washington was born on a farm near Hale's Ford in the foothills of the Blue Ridge Mountains in Franklin County, Virginia, most likely on April 5, 1856. Washington spent the first eight years of his childhood as a slave. Following emancipation he moved with his mother, brother, and sister to join his stepfather, who had found employment in the saltworks in Malden, West Virginia. Elizabeth Cady was born on November 12, 1815, to Daniel Cady, a judge, and Margaret Livingston Cady, a homemaker, in Johnstown, New York. Raised with four sisters and one brother, she led the life of a privileged miss. When her older brother died, her grieving father told the eleven-year-old Cady that he wished she were a boy. Margaret Higgins was born into a working-class family on September 14, 1879, in Corning, New York, the sixth of eleven children. Her father, a stonecutter, was an activist for woman suffrage and Socialism. Sanger was educated at St. Mary's School in Corning, New York, and then attended Claverack College in Claverack and the Hudson River Institute in Hudson. After graduating from Colgate University, Powell became active in Harlem's Abyssinian Baptist Church, where his father was minister. He received a master's degree from Columbia University, followed by theological studies at Shaw University, and assumed leadership of the Abyssinian Baptist Church congregation in 1937. Born in Boston in 1811, Wendell Phillips joined the American Anti-Slavery Society in 1837, associating thereafter with the abolitionist William Lloyd Garrison, that movement's most visible and divisive leader. Alice Paul, one of the nation's most outspoken suffragists and feminists in the early twentieth century and beyond, was born to a Quaker family at their Paulsdale estate in Mount Laurel, New Jersey, on January 11, 1885. Her religious background is relevant because the Hicksite Quakerism the family practiced placed a great deal of emphasis on gender equality. Barbara Jordan was born in Houston, Texas, in 1936 and grew up during a time of racial segregation throughout the South. As an African American, she became increasingly aware of the limitations imposed by segregation when she traveled outside the South as a member of the Texas Southern University debate team in the early 1950s. William Franklin Graham, Jr., was born on November 7, 1918, on a dairy farm near Charlotte, North Carolina. His parents, zealous members of the Associate Reformed Presbyterian Church, enjoyed a reasonable standard of living and avoided many of the social and economic ills associated with the 1930s and the Great Depression. William Lloyd Garrison was born in Newburyport, Massachusetts, on December 10, 1805. From his teens he worked in the newspaper-publishing business. Then, in 1831, he published the first issue of his Boston newspaper, the Liberator, which until the end of 1865 served as his personal vehicle for broadcasting his many controversial opinions, most notably that slavery must be immediately abolished and that people of all skin colors must be treated as equals. Sarah Margaret Fuller was born in Cambridge port (now part of Cambridge), Massachusetts, in 1810. Her childhood was dominated by her father, Timothy Fuller, who gave her a rigorous education in literature and philosophy at home. Influenced by such German Romantic writers as Johann Goethe, she embraced the belief that God was found in both man and nature and that each individual was responsible for his or her own moral advancement. William Edward Burghardt Du Bois was born on February 23, 1868, in Great Barrington, Massachusetts, and raised by his mother. In spite of the poverty of his childhood, Du Bois excelled in school and achieved one of the most impressive educations of his generation. He received bachelor degrees from Fisk University and Harvard University, pursued graduate work at Harvard and Germany's University of Berlin, and earned his PhD in history from Harvard in 1895. Eugene Victor Debs was a trade union leader, orator, and frequent Socialist Party candidate for the presidency of the United States. He was born in Terre Haute, Indiana, in 1855. While working his way up through the hierarchy of the Brotherhood of Locomotive Firemen, an important railroad union, he was elected city clerk in Terre Haute in 1879. Cesar Estrada Chavez was born to the children of Mexican immigrants in a small Arizona town in 1927. He experienced discrimination from an early age. In school his teachers punished him for speaking Spanish, and his classmates teased him because of his ethnicity. At age ten he moved with his family to California, where they and hundreds of thousands of others sought work as migrant laborers. Susan Brownell Anthony, who devoted more than a half century to women's suffrage and other social issues, was born in Adams, Massachusetts, on February 15, 1820. She received her education at a Quaker boarding school in Philadelphia, where she trained as a teacher, an occupation she pursued for three years beginning in 1846. Jane Addams, the eighth of nine children, was born on September 6, 1860, in Cedarville, Illinois, into a wealthy family of Quaker background. Addams was a member of the first generation of American women to attend college. She graduated in 1881 from Rockford Female Seminary, in Illinois, which the following year became Rockford College for Women, allowing Addams to obtain her bachelor's degree.
